1. William J. Clinton Presidential Library and Museum:
One cannot visit Downtown Little Rock without stopping by the iconic Clinton Presidential Library and Museum. Situated on the banks of the Arkansas River, this impressive facility houses an extensive collection of artifacts and exhibits that tell the story of President Bill Clinton’s two terms in office. Visitors can explore replica Oval Office, immerse themselves in the interactive exhibits, and even see a piece of the Berlin Wall. The beauty and educational value of the museum make it an unmissable destination for history enthusiasts.

3. Little Rock Central High School National Historic Site:
A testament to the Civil Rights Movement, the Little Rock Central High School National Historic Site is a must-visit for anyone interested in American history. This high school played a crucial role in the desegregation of schools in the United States when nine African-American students attempted to attend the formerly all-white school in 1957. The visitor center showcases exhibits and videos that detail this pivotal moment in history, and guests can also go on guided tours of the school. The site serves as a reminder of the bravery and determination of those who fought for equal rights.

4. The Old State House Museum:
Situated in the heart of downtown, the Old State House Museum is a beautifully preserved building that holds significant historical and cultural importance. Constructed in the 1830s, it served as the state’s capitol building until 1911 and witnessed pivotal moments in Arkansas’s history. The museum’s exhibits offer an immersive journey through time, from the state’s territorial period to the present day. Artifacts, photographs, and interactive displays bring the history of Arkansas to life, making it a fascinating destination for history enthusiasts of all ages.
